Soviet-era sports colossus with a preserved Stalinist facade, rebuilt inside to host a World Cup final.
This guide to Luzhniki Stadium in Moscow returns to the night of October 20, 1982, when Spartak Moscow hosted Haarlem in the UEFA Cup on a freezing, half-empty ground then called Central Lenin Stadium. It follows the single open exit stairway police left for the crowd, and the scramble that began when fans heading out collided with fans rushing back in after a late goal. A journalist who was there recalls what he saw on the stairs that night, and a mother who searched for her son long after the final whistle.
